Pay the additional tax. You probably received more in advanced child credit than you reported.
Bsch4477 is probably correct that you did not enter your advance payments correctly into TurboTax (this has been very common this year, despite the warnings from the IRS).
I assume that the IRS letter invited you to reply. If you believe that your entries were correct, then you can reply with whatever evidence you have showing that you reported the advance payments correctly (assuming that this is the problem).
I had the same problem. TurboTax doesn't have the "line 5 worksheet" for Schedule 8812 so I found it on the IRS site. https://www.irs.gov/instructions/i1040s8#en_US_2021_publink100077560
When I ran the calculations myself, using the values reported to IRS, it's clear it was the IRS that messed up. I will be contacting them to hopefully correct the problem.
